- UMB Student Entrepreneurs Share Business Ideas at GRID Pitch 2023(1:53) University of Maryland, Baltimore students share their ideas for inventions and businesses that haven't been created yet during the sixth annual Grid Pitch.The Grid Pitch is a showcase that allows for UMB students to pitch their innovative business ideas to a panel of experts and investors in the entrepreneurial community. Accepted participants will receive five weeks of one-on-one coaching and mentoring from an experienced entrepreneur or business expert.#studentexperience #entrepreneurship

- What Do Actors Have to do with Medical Training and Education?(3:12) Actors are helping medical profession students at the University of Maryland, Baltimore, posing as patients in simulated scenarios. These actors are called Standardized Patients, and several of these actors helped about 400 students from disciplines across the University work collaboratively at the 11th Annual Interprofessional Education (IPE) Day on March 29, 2023. The event is hosted by UMB’s Center for Interprofessional Education.Each year, the all-day event includes hands-on practice with the SPs on scenarios where students in nursing, pharmacy, medicine, public health, social work, law, and dentistry are required to work in a team-based model to provide a wraparound care approach for an intrpfoessional collaboration in health care.Learn more: https://www.umaryland.edu/news/archived-news/march-2023/treating-the-whole-patient-through-collaborative-care.php#StandardizedPatient #medicalcollege #medicalschool #acting
